What is the cheapest month to fly from Edmonton to Costa Rica?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Edmonton to Costa Rica,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Edmonton to Costa Rica is February, when tickets cost C$ 257 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and June,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is C$ 626 and C$ 529 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Edmonton to Costa Rica?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Edmonton to Costa Rica,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below-average price on a flight from Edmonton to Costa Rica, you should book around 4 weeks before departure, which saves you about 49%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 13 weeks before departure.

FAQs - booking Costa Rica flights

  • Can I fly non-stop from Edmonton to San Jose, Costa Rica?

    It is unlikely that you will find a non-stop flight from Edmonton (YEG) to Costa Rica (SJO). However, Air Transat and Air Canada operate flights that stop once in Toronto (YYZ). Delta also offers a one-stop flight with a connection city in Los Angeles (LAX). You can also find a number of flights between YEG and SJO with two stops.

  • Can I rent a car from the Juan Santamaria International Airport (SJO) when my plane lands in Edmonton?

    You can reserve a car at one of the on-site car rental agencies in the arrival section of the SJO terminal. Or you could save some money on extra fees by reserving a car at a nearby off-site location and having them pick you up at the airport. Hertz, Budget, and Enterprise are some of the car rental agencies at SJO.

  • Do I need a visa to fly from Edmonton to Costa Rica?

    Tourists traveling from Edmonton to Costa Rica do not need a visa as long as they intend to leave within 180 days. However, to enter the country, you need to have a passport that remains valid for at least one day after entry, proof that you have at least $100 USD per month of your stay in Costa Rica, and a return ticket or onward travel that is within the 180-day time frame.

  • Where can I park my car affordably at the Edmonton International Airport (YEG) when I fly to Costa Rica?

    At the Edmonton Airport, you can park in the Value Park lot. At this affordable long-term lot, you can get assistance with your luggage or if you have car trouble. Security patrols this lot which includes accessible parking. It is a short walk from the terminal, or you can take a free shuttle to the terminals.

Top tips for finding cheap flights to Costa Rica

  • Travelers flying from Edmonton to Costa Rica will most likely depart from the Edmonton International Airport (YEG). Situated south of downtown Edmonton, this airport serves as a hub for Flair Airlines, WestJet, Swoop, and Central Mountain Air, among other airlines.
  • The most popular destination for passengers flying from Edmonton to Costa Rica is the capital city of San Jose. You will be arriving at the Juan Santamaria International Airport (SJO). Serving as the primary gateway to central Costa Rica, this airport serves as a hub for Volaris Costa Rica, Avianca Costa Rica, and Sansa Airlines.
  • When you are booking an airline ticket from Edmonton (YEG) to the airport in San Jose, Costa Rica (SJO), be very careful that you make your reservation for the correct San Jose. Do not inadvertently purchase a ticket for San Jose, California. The code for the San Jose, California airport is SJC, which sounds similar to SJO.
  • If you would like to wait for your flight to Costa Rica in refined comfort at the Edmonton International Airport, you can pay an entrance fee to access the exclusive Plaza Premium Lounge. Located in the Domestic/International Departures, this lounge is on Level 2 near Gate 54.
  • Flights from Edmonton YEG to Costa Rica also land in the city of Liberia, in the northwest of the country. You will land at the Daniel Oduber Quiros International Airport (LIR). WestJet operates several flights with one stop in Calgary (YYC), Air Canada with one stop in Montreal (YUL) or Toronto (YYZ), and United with one stop in Denver (DEN).
